The New Visual Standards: AI and Object Recognition
In 2026, photos are no longer just for show. Google’s Vision AI has reached a point where it “reads” the content of your images to verify your services and location. If you’re a roofing contractor in Stockton but your photos only show generic shingles and no recognizable Stockton landmarks or your branded trucks on Stockton streets, Google’s trust in your location decreases.
High-resolution, geo-tagged images are now mandatory. When you upload a photo of a completed project near Victory Park, the metadata (EXIF data) and the visual cues in the background (like the distinctive Stockton water towers or local street signs) tell Google’s AI exactly where you are and what you do. Review Management & Automation: Velocity and Sentiment
The old advice was “get as many 5-star reviews as possible.” In 2026, that advice is incomplete and potentially dangerous. Google’s AI is now incredibly adept at spotting “review clusters” and inorganic growth. If you get 20 reviews in one week and then none for a month, you trigger a spam flag. The new mantra is Review Velocity and Sentiment Depth.
Google is looking for a consistent, natural flow of reviews. More importantly, it is reading the content of those reviews. A review that says “Great job!” is worth almost nothing. A review that says, “The team arrived on time at my home in Quail Lakes and fixed my AC faster than any other Stockton HVAC company I’ve used,” is gold. It contains location signals (Quail Lakes), service signals (AC fix), and sentiment (faster than others).

Technical Fixes: Schema and NAP Consistency
While the front-end of your Google Business Profile (GBP) is what customers see, the back-end is what Google’s bots rely on. This is where many Stockton businesses fail. Your “Invisible Code” – specifically Schema.org (LocalBusiness Schema) – must perfectly align with your GBP data. Any discrepancy between the address on your website, your GBP, and your listing on the Stockton Chamber of Commerce site can cause a “trust gap.”
NAP (Name, Address, Phone) consistency is more critical than ever because AI doesn’t handle ambiguity well. If your business is listed as “Stockton Plumbing & Drain” in one place and “Stockton Plumbing” in another, the AI may treat them as two separate, weaker entities rather than one strong one. You should use a google business profile audit tool to scan the web for these inconsistencies immediately.
Implementing advanced Schema allows you to tell Google exactly what hours you are open, what neighborhoods you serve, and even what your price range is, all in a language the AI understands perfectly.
